Monica Hutchinson

Monica Hutchinson is a wife and proud mother of three amazing teenage boys. She is currently a Community Organizer with the VA Campaign for Family Friendly Economy, where she organizes around family centered issues like paid leave, elder care, child care, living wage, and more. A transplant from Queens, New York, she is passionate about her communities in Virginia and inspires many with her vision of a Commonwealth where everyone works together towards racial, social and political justice.  She is driven to fight for issues including civil rights, equity and equality, voting rights, restorative criminal justice reform, education, women reproductive rights, LGBTQ+, immigration, healthcare, living wage, paid leave, and more. 

She is a graduate of the Virginia Progressive Leadership Project(Cohort 5), Alumna of the Black Campaign School, and serves multiple organizations with volunteer and civic engagement including the Henrico NAACP where she currently serves as Communications Chair and mentor for the Henrico NAACP Youth and College Chapter, Henrico County Public Schools Special Education Advisory Committee where she serves as Vice-Chair of Planning, and Henrico County Democratic Committee where she formed and is also the Chair of the Henrico County Democratic Black Caucus. Monica is a 2020 VA state and 2020 Virginia At-Large National Delegate for VP Joe Biden, member of the Women for Biden digital grassroots team, she is part of the leadership team for Women of Color Coalition for Biden Harris, Virginia Women for Biden, and Virginia African Americans for Biden. Monica enjoys engaging her community on the issues that most impact them, and challenges all to see the world through a lens of equity, diversity, and inclusion.
